ANALISIS SISTEM INFORMASI PEMERINTAHAN DAERAH REPUBLIK INDONESIA (SIPD RI) DALAM PENERBITAN SP2D ONLINE GAJI ASN DI BPKAD PROVINSI SUMATERA SELATAN
SIPD RI is a web-based information system designed to support regional financial management processes, including the issuance of Online Fund Disbursement Orders (SP2D) for Civil Servants’ (ASN) salaries. This study aims to analyze the success of the Republic of Indonesia Regional Government Information System (SIPD RI) in the issuance of Online SP2D for ASN salaries at the Regional Financial and Asset Management Agency (BPKAD) of South Sumatra Province, based on the DeLone and McLean Information Systems Success Model (2003), which comprises System Quality,Information Quality, Service Quality, System Use, User Satisfaction, and Net Benefits. This research employs a descriptive qualitative research method. Data were collected through interviews, documentation, and observations. The results indicate that SIPD RI has performed well in terms of flexibility, system and feature availability, speed, and ease of use, although its reliability is still influenced by the quality of OPD network connectivity. The information provided is considered relevant and easy to understand; however, data completeness and personalization require further improvement. System management services are generally perceived as good, yet responsiveness to technical issues remains relatively slow. The use of SIPD RI is highly consistent and aligned with operational needs, supported by a high frequency of access and the system’s ability to handle large transaction volumes. Users express satisfaction due to the system’s ease of use and regulatory requirements, while net benefits are reflected in improved time efficiency and faster salary disbursement processes. Overall, SIPD RI contributes positively to the success of issuing Online SP2D for ASN salaries, although further development is still required to achieve full digitalization across all types of financial transactions.
